    For over 20 years, the MetroWest Nonprofit Network (MWNN) has strengthened nonprofit organizations by improving interagency communication, sharing ideas and information, and providing expertise on topics of mutual interest.

    We keep nonprofit professionals connected to the resources needed to make small and medium-sized nonprofit organizations more effective, more efficient, and better able to meet their missions.

    MWNN services over 275 nonprofits based in the Metrowest area of eastern Massachusetts (approximately the area bordered by Routes 128, 495, 17, and 2). However, we enjoy the participation of people from all over the state, especially Greater Boston and central Massachusetts.

    MWNN is not a membership organization; the public is welcome to attend all of our programs.
